For Indian students University of Melbourne cost 2025 for UG programs range from AUD 38424 to AUD 59813 per year (₹21.68 Lakhs to ₹33.75 Lakhs).
The PG program fees at University of Melbourne range from AUD 6000 to AUD 119700 per year (₹3.39 Lakhs to ₹67.53 Lakhs).

The annual cost of living in Melbourne, Australia for University of Melbourne students is approximately AUD 38445 (INR 21.69 Lakhs). This includes rent, utilities, food, transport, and other personal expenses.

The Architecture programs at the University of Melbourne teach you to apply design thinking, develop creative solutions, and imagine future environments for living, working, and playing. You will learn to leverage increasingly sophisticated digital capabilities to solve problems in an age of environmental change, rapid urbanization, and global flows of people, materials, and assets.
You will learn how to use technology to represent environments in 2D and 3D (analog and digital), develop expertise in structural and material systems as well as building science and environmental systems, and gain a deep appreciation for design history (architectural, landscape and urban).
Your learning will be put into practice in design studio classes. Along with lectures and tutorials, you’ll attend site visits and spend time in the fabrication workshop and research library, where ideas, skills, and knowledge can be learned, shared, debated, and tested.
